What is Cold Foam, and Why is Everyone Raving About It?
In case you've been living under a rock, cold foam is essentially cold, whipped cream for your coffee. But it's so much more than that. It's a fluffy, airy, and absolutely delightful topping that's taken the coffee world by storm. Dunkin' introduced their version of cold foam in 2019, and it's been a game-changer ever since.
Cold foam is made by steaming and texturizing cold milk, then cooling it down. This process creates tiny, stable bubbles that sit on top of your coffee like a cloud of deliciousness. It's not too sweet, not too heavy, just perfectly balanced to complement your favorite coffee drinks.

Cold Foam Recipes: Because You Can't Have Too Much of a Good Thing
If you're feeling adventurous, you can also create your own cold foam concoctions at home. Here are a couple of recipes to get you started:
Iced Americano with Cold Foam
- 1. Brew a strong cup of coffee or espresso and let it cool.
- 2. Fill a glass with ice.
- 3. Pour the cooled coffee over the ice, filling the glass about 3/4 full.
- 4. Top with cold foam and enjoy!
Cold Foam Iced Latte
- 1. Brew a cup of coffee and let it cool.
- 2. Fill a glass with ice.
- 3. Pour the cooled coffee over the ice, filling the glass about 1/2 full.
- 4. Top with cold foam and fill the rest of the glass with milk.
- 5. Stir gently and enjoy!
Cold Foam Hacks: Because Life's Too Short for Bad Coffee
Here are a few tips to help you make the most of your cold foam experience:
- Timing is everything: Pour your cold foam onto your coffee right before you drink it. The longer it sits, the more it melts. - Stir it up: Don't be afraid to mix your cold foam into your coffee. It's delicious either way! - Don't forget the classics: Cold foam isn't just for iced coffee. Try it on hot coffee or even chai lattes for a unique twist.
